Most of the commensal and pathogenic gram-unfavorable bacteria have been revealed to variety biofilms. These biofilms present security for the bacterial cell and resilience to those bacterial populations from different medicine and antibiotics. LPS modification by palmitoylation is probably the methods that lead to secure biofilm formation. The bacterias which include E.coli and Pseudomonas aeruginosa Screen improved incorporation of palmitate acyl chain within the lipid A moiety. Palmitic acid imparts greater hydrophobicity to LPS, that's inherent to biofilms forming over both of those biotic and abiotic surfaces. Biofilms are refractory to drug therapy, and thus micro organism can build a resistant phenotype in vivo.

Thermal processing might have equally helpful and deleterious consequences on zeaxanthin bioavailability for the duration of foods preparing. By way of check here example, it could hurt the content material of zeaxanthin in Uncooked meals, though it also can aid the discharge and solubilization of zeaxanthin for higher bioavailability [7]. During food items processing, a higher temperature may well considerably lessen the concentrations of zeaxanthin, as is reported in sweet corn, the place canning at 121 °C lessened zeaxanthin material by 29% [7].
